The Government of India has greenlit the Modernisation of Command Area Development and Water Management (M-CADWM) scheme under the broader framework of the Pradhan Mantri Krishi Sinchayee Yojana (PMKSY). Set to be rolled out during the 2025-2026 financial year, the initiative has been allocated an initial budget of Rupees 1,600 crore to revamp irrigation infrastructure and improve water distribution systems nationwide.
Key Objectives Of M-CADWM Initiative
The core aim of M-CADWM is to upgrade and modernise existing irrigation systems, with a specific focus on boosting water-use efficiency. Targeting small and marginal farmers, the scheme is designed to ensure reliable and equitable water delivery to agricultural fields through technologically enhanced supply networks.
Integration Of Advanced Technology
The scheme leverages modern technologies such as SCADA (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ition) and the Internet of Things (IoT) to streamline water management. These tools will aid in real-time monitoring and control, ensuring optimal utilisation of water resources and helping farmers achieve greater efficiency in irrigation.
Infrastructure Upgrades And Last-Mile Connectivity
One of the major features of the scheme is the development of underground pressurised piped irrigation systems, enabling water supply up to 1-hectare fields. This infrastructure supports the adoption of micro-irrigation techniques, contributing to water conservation and increased crop productivity.
Empowering Water User Societies (WUS)
The scheme promotes community-led water governance by transferring irrigation management responsibilities to Water User Societies (WUS) under the Irrigation Management Transfer (IMT) framework. These groups will be supported for five years and encouraged to partner with Farmer Producer Organisations (FPOs) and Primary Agricultural Cooperative Societies (PACS) to strengthen grassroots implementation.
Encouraging Sustainable And Smart Farming Practices
By advancing water delivery mechanisms and promoting efficient irrigation methods, M-CADWM aims to support eco-friendly farming. It is expected to improve overall agricultural output and sustainability, aligning with long-term food security and environmental goals.
Engaging Youth In Agriculture
With the inclusion of smart technologies and modern practices, the scheme also aims to attract younger generations to farming. By offering advanced tools and systems, it opens up opportunities for innovation and entrepreneurship in agriculture.
Pilot Implementation And Future Expansion
The initial phase will roll out as pilot projects at 78 locations, impacting nearly 80,000 farmers across diverse agro-climatic regions. Insights from these pilot runs will inform the development of a National Plan for Command Area Development and Water Management, scheduled for launch in April 2026.
